Insider is the second album of the Manchester alternative rock band Amplifier. It was released by the German-based label SPV on 29 September in Germany and Austria then in the rest of Europe on 2 October. All songs by Sel Balamir

Amplifier are an alternative rock trio from Manchester, England fronted by singer and guitarist Sel Balamir. The band’s self-titled debut album was released in 2004 by Music for Nations.     Amplifier is the debut album of the Manchester alternative rock band Amplifier. Originally released by Music For Nations on June 6, 2004, it was re-released by the German-based label SPV in May 2005 after the collapse of the former.
